Immerse yourself in history with two memorable events on September 14th.  See five exceptional homes, the Avery House, the 1882 Fort Collins Water Works, plus the former Washington School, now home to Colorado State University's Early Childhood Center. 

On tour day, enjoy lunch at our Landmark Luncheon to be held at the 1934 Hunter House. This delicious catered event will feature special entertainment and tours of the magnificent English Revival Cottage home.

Poudre Landmarks Foundation has a vision of a Fort Collins community that understands, appreciates, and values its past. Our mission is to preserve, restore, protect, and interpret the architectural and cultural heritage of the Fort Collins area.
